If not, it’s time to go out and gather information from your crop adviser to help interpret the symptoms in your crop. A good knowledge of nutrient deficiency symptoms is re quired as much as an under standing of water, temper ature, salinity, and pest stresses. Phosphorus and potassium move in the soil mainly by the short-range process of diffu sion. Cool soils and dry con ditions can slow the diffusion process, reducing the ability of the soil to supply these nu trients to the plant. In addi tion, plant roots grow slowly in cool soils, further minimiz ing the contact between the plant and soil. These are rea sons seed placement of phos phorus and potassium fertilizer can be critical to overcoming early season defi ciencies. Ph osphorus deficient cereal seedlings generally dis play poor tillering, stunted growth, and yellowing of the lower leaves. Many tarmers have seen this dramatic affect on growth in their fields when they either ran out of phosphorus fertilizer or had a mechanical failure while seeding. A severely deficient seedling may display a dark green to purplish tinge on the margins of lower leaves. Early potassium deficiency usually appears as chlorosis (yellowing) of the older plant leaves. Potassium is a mobile nutrient in the plant. As a consequence, when the roots are no longer picking up a balance of potassium to the other nutrients, the plant will start to take potassium from the older leaves, transferring them to younger plant tissue. This is what distinguishes a potassium deficiency from sulfur (only upper, new leaves) and nitrogen (all leaves). Alfalfa, a large con sumer of potassium, displays small white spots on the lower leaflets. If the defi ciency persists, this chlorosis is followed by necrosis (death) of the leaf tissue starting at the margins of older leaves. Don’t forget tissue testing! If you are suspicious of a nu trient deficiency, be sure to do some in-season tissue test ing to build your case for cor rective action. Remember to sample and compare both good and problem areas in the field. Field scouting, soil and tissue testing, and monitoring for nutrient deficiencies are useful tools for crop manage ment.
